Output fe75c262e3a88c3d4c436205e72868a50785f19ce52b685b36edb7aa9655ae01:1

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d758b02997386504aa6c2a30ea945f49cdffe18 OP_EQUALVERIFY OP_CHECKSIG
address
1MBy9Rhp5oZCiCwgLcn1kzmDjyprvRZAuH
transaction
fe75c262e3a88c3d4c436205e72868a50785f19ce52b685b36edb7aa9655ae01
spent
true